[HoneySelect2补丁]完全掌握指南:从入门到精通的7个关键步骤
2026-05-01 11:51:03作者:魏侃纯Zoe
问题引入:游戏本地化的核心挑战 🧩
在全球化游戏体验中,玩家常面临三大核心痛点:语言障碍导致剧情理解困难、区域限制影响内容完整性、手动更新补丁繁琐易错。HoneySelect2补丁作为一站式解决方案,通过自动化技术栈解决这些问题,为玩家提供无缝的本地化体验。本指南将系统拆解其技术原理与实施路径,帮助用户实现从基础安装到高级定制的全流程掌握。
核心优势:技术架构解析 ⚡
HoneySelect2补丁采用模块化设计,核心优势体现在三个维度:
- 智能翻译引擎:基于上下文感知的动态翻译系统,支持17种语言实时转换,翻译准确率达92%以上
- 内容适配框架:自动识别游戏版本并应用对应解锁策略,避免区域限制导致的功能缺失
- 增量更新机制:采用差量补丁技术,更新包体积减少70%,显著降低网络传输成本
准备工作:环境兼容性验证 📋
系统需求确认
-
硬件配置
- 存储空间:至少2GB可用空间(建议预留5GB以上用于缓存)
- 内存:8GB及以上(翻译缓存需占用约1.5GB内存)
- 显卡:支持DirectX 11的GPU(确保UI渲染正常)
-
软件环境
- 游戏版本:HoneySelect2 1.20及以上完整安装版
- 运行权限:管理员账户(确保文件系统写入权限)
- 安全设置:临时关闭实时防护(避免安装文件被误报)
资源获取
通过以下命令克隆完整项目仓库:
git clone https://gitcode.com/gh_mirrors/hs/HS2-HF_Patch
实施步骤:3步完成基础配置,实现全功能启用 🔧
步骤1:文件部署
- 将克隆的HS2-HF_Patch文件夹复制到游戏根目录
- 确认目录结构完整性:确保包含HelperLib、_Common等子目录
- 验证标准:游戏根目录下出现patch.iss文件即表示部署成功
步骤2:安装配置
- 双击运行patch.iss启动安装向导
- 在组件选择界面勾选所需功能模块(建议默认全选)
- 选择安装路径为游戏根目录(通常为Steam/steamapps/common/HoneySelect2)
- 验证标准:安装完成后生成HF_Patch_config.ini配置文件
步骤3:功能验证
- 启动游戏并观察启动界面是否出现HF Patch标识
- 进入设置菜单检查语言选项是否包含中文等新增语言
- 加载任意剧情场景测试翻译功能是否正常工作
- 验证标准:游戏内文本显示正常,无乱码或未翻译内容
高级技巧:4个场景化配置方案 🚀
场景1:低配置设备优化
- 降低翻译缓存大小至256MB(修改HF_Patch_config.ini中CacheSize参数)
- 禁用实时翻译预览功能(设置LivePreview=false)
- 效果:内存占用减少40%,游戏帧率提升15-20fps
场景2:多语言环境切换
- 在游戏内按F12调出语言控制台
- 输入语言代码快速切换(如"zh-CN"切换至简体中文)
- 设置自动检测系统语言(EnableAutoDetect=true)
- 应用价值:满足多语言家庭或国际玩家群体使用需求
场景3:内容过滤定制
- 编辑_Common/Translations.iss文件
- 添加自定义过滤规则(如屏蔽特定内容关键词)
- 使用正则表达式实现高级内容过滤
- 注意事项:修改前建议备份原始配置文件
场景4:开发模式启用
- 在配置文件中设置DeveloperMode=true
- 启用调试日志(LogLevel=Verbose)
- 使用HelperLib/ProcessTools.cs开发自定义处理模块
- 应用场景:为模组开发者提供扩展接口
常见问题:故障排查与解决方案 🔍
问题现象:安装程序无响应
- 排查流程
- 检查任务管理器是否存在多个安装进程
- 验证游戏目录权限是否为"完全控制"
- 查看系统事件日志中的应用程序错误记录
- 解决方案
- 以兼容模式运行安装程序(右键→属性→兼容性→Windows 8)
- 手动注册缺失的.NET组件:
regsvr32 "C:\Windows\Microsoft.NET\Framework\v4.0.30319\mscorlib.dll" - 清理临时文件后重试安装
问题现象:翻译功能失效
- 排查流程
- 确认HF_Patch_config.ini中Language参数是否正确
- 检查翻译缓存目录是否存在(默认%APPDATA%\HF_Patch\Cache)
- 验证网络连接是否正常(首次运行需要下载语言包)
- 解决方案
- 删除缓存目录后重启游戏重新下载语言包
- 手动替换语言文件:将_Common目录下对应语言文件复制到游戏Data文件夹
- 检查防火墙设置是否阻止程序访问网络
问题现象:游戏启动崩溃
- 排查流程
- 查看游戏根目录下HF_Patch.log文件
- 确认游戏版本与补丁版本是否匹配
- 检查是否存在冲突的第三方模组
- 解决方案
- 运行HelperLib/Verifier.cs验证文件完整性
- 暂时移除所有第三方模组后测试
- 重新安装游戏运行库(vcredist_x64.exe)
维护指南:系统优化与长期管理 🛡️
定期维护任务
-
每周检查
- 运行补丁目录下的UpdateChecker.exe检查更新
- 清理翻译缓存(建议保留最近3个版本的缓存文件)
- 验证游戏文件完整性(通过Steam验证或Verifier工具)
-
每月优化
- 执行磁盘碎片整理(提升大文件加载速度)
- 备份配置文件(HF_Patch_config.ini和Translations.iss)
- 清理日志文件(保留最近7天的日志记录)
版本管理策略
- 启用自动更新(AutoUpdate=true)但设置更新提醒
- 重要版本更新前创建系统还原点
- 使用版本控制工具管理自定义配置文件变更
性能监控
- 关注游戏内帧率变化(正常范围:30-60fps)
- 监控内存占用(稳定状态应低于4GB)
- 定期检查磁盘空间(翻译缓存每月增长约500MB)
通过本指南的系统学习,您已掌握HoneySelect2补丁从基础安装到高级定制的完整流程。记住,技术工具的价值在于解决实际问题,建议根据个人需求灵活调整配置方案,必要时参考项目文档或社区支持获取最新技术动态。持续优化配置将为您带来更流畅的游戏体验。
登录后查看全文
热门项目推荐
相关项目推荐
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ust0147- DDeepSeek-V4-ProDeepSeek-V4-Pro(总参数 1.6 万亿,激活 49B)面向复杂推理和高级编程任务,在代码竞赛、数学推理、Agent 工作流等场景表现优异,性能接近国际前沿闭源模型。Python00
GLM-5.1GLM-5.1是智谱迄今最智能的旗舰模型,也是目前全球最强的开源模型。GLM-5.1大大提高了代码能力,在完成长程任务方面提升尤为显著。和此前分钟级交互的模型不同,它能够在一次任务中独立、持续工作超过8小时,期间自主规划、执行、自我进化,最终交付完整的工程级成果。Jinja00
MiniCPM-V-4.6这是 MiniCPM-V 系列有史以来效率与性能平衡最佳的模型。它以仅 1.3B 的参数规模,实现了性能与效率的双重突破,在全球同尺寸模型中登顶,全面超越了阿里 Qwen3.5-0.8B 与谷歌 Gemma4-E2B-it。Jinja00
Intern-S2-PreviewIntern-S2-Preview,这是一款高效的350亿参数科学多模态基础模型。除了常规的参数与数据规模扩展外,Intern-S2-Preview探索了任务扩展:通过提升科学任务的难度、多样性与覆盖范围,进一步释放模型能力。Python00
skillhubopenJiuwen 生态的 Skill 托管与分发开源方案,支持自建与可选 ClawHub 兼容。Python0111
热门内容推荐
最新内容推荐
项目优选
收起
暂无描述
Dockerfile
731
4.73 K
Ascend Extension for PyTorch
Python
609
785
openEuler内核是openEuler操作系统的核心,既是系统性能与稳定性的基石,也是连接处理器、设备与服务的桥梁。
C
433
391
本项目是CANN提供的数学类基础计算算子库,实现网络在NPU上加速计算。
C++
996
1 K
昇腾LLM分布式训练框架
Python
166
197
暂无简介
Dart
983
249
deepin linux kernel
C
29
16
华为昇腾面向大规模分布式训练的多模态大模型套件,支撑多模态生成、多模态理解。
Python
145
237
旨在打造算法先进、性能卓越、高效敏捷、安全可靠的密码套件,通过轻量级、可剪裁的软件技术架构满足各行业不同场景的多样化要求,让密码技术应用更简单,同时探索后量子等先进算法创新实践,构建密码前沿技术底座!
C
1.1 K
611
Claude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ed.
Get Started
Rust
1.14 K
146